聚合物刷接枝新方法与润滑研究
关键字:polymer brushes,ATRP,lubrication Surface-initiated controlled radical polymerizations (SIP) from initiator-modified surfaces lead to polymer brushes with variable compositions, architectures and functionalities, as well as complex (co)polymers and organic/inorganic hybrid materials. Among the different controlled radical polymerization techniques, atom transfer radical polymerization (ATRP) is widely used for tailoring the su...

ICPE-9000有机系统测定润滑油中金属元素含量
本文采用重量稀释法处理润滑油,无需消解,使用ICP-AES有机系统进行直接测定,研究了润滑油中磨损金属元素和添加剂金属含量的测定。实验结果表明,所测元素线性关系及重复性良好,定量准确,回收率在91.7~110.0%之间,方法检出限在0.014~0.57 mg/Kg之间。ICP-AES测定润滑油中各种金属含量,具有快速、高效、清洁、污染少等优点,完全能满足生产中监控机械使用状态的要求。
